## Formula sandbox tuning

User-supplied formulas in Gridmoor execute inside a restricted interpreter with hard ceilings on time, memory, and call depth. Reviewers should confirm any change to these ceilings is justified in the PR description, since raising them widens the abuse surface. Defaults were chosen from production traces. The current limits are as follows.

limits module of tafog-fawip:
WEIGHTS = {
    "julix": 57,
    "lamys": 992,
    "kasvan": 209,
    "quenok": 750,
    "alddor": 259,
    "oliath": 1009,
    "wenix": 815,
}

Handover: Tovak audit-log viewer

Rena — picking up where I left off. Viewer reads from the append-only store via the cursor API; pagination is keyset-based, no offsets. Filters compile server-side, so don't add client filtering. Export is capped at 10k rows, intentional. Known gap: retention banner doesn't refresh after policy change, ticket filed. Tests green except one flaky snapshot. Review the permissions middleware first, it's the riskiest bit. Current service config is below.

settings of tagef-bawif:
DRUIX_HOST=druix.zemvarlabs.internal
DRUIX_PORT=8000

Team — Sheetforge export workers are spiking past 6 GB on large workbook exports since Tuesday's rollout. Root cause looks like the new cell-style interner holding the full sheet in memory instead of streaming. Mitigation: cap export size at 200k rows via the feature flag until the fix lands. On-call: watch the Varnholt cluster dashboards overnight and restart any worker above threshold. Fix is staged; the candidate build is referenced by the token below.

build token for kagaf-hahof: htk14_9d3d4d26d7d8de

**FAQ: Why do Ledgerhop integration tests fail intermittently?**

Most flakiness traces back to the sandbox settlement worker, which occasionally lags behind the test clock. Support should first re-run the suite with the `--settle-wait` flag before escalating. If the sandbox itself is wedged, you may need to reset the test vault, which requires elevated access. To perform that reset, authenticate with the recovery passphrase provided immediately below.

strongbox words: ulaael-caswyn